Short-Term Antioxidant Effects of Vitamin E-Coated Filters During Continuous Kidney Replacement Therapy in Critically

Introduction:
This study aimed to assess the short-term antioxidant effects of a vitamin E-coated membrane during continuous kidney replacement therapy (CKRT) based on the neutrophil-to-lymphocyte ratio (NLR) and red cell distribution width (RDW).
Methods:
CKRT sessions conducted between December 2023 and May 2025 at a single tertiary-care center were retrospectively analyzed. Based on the type of hemofilter used, sessions were categorized into polysulfone membrane (PS) and vitamin E-coated membrane (VE) groups. Laboratory parameters at CKRT initiation and 48 h thereafter were compared between the two groups.
Results:
Overall, 79 CKRT sessions (33 patients) were analyzed. In the PS group, NLR and RDW-SD increased significantly (p < 0.01 and p = 0.03), whereas no significant changes were observed in the VE group.
Conclusion:
Vitamin E-coated membranes may exert short-term antioxidant effects during CKRT by reducing inflammatory and oxidative responses as reflected by NLR and RDW.
